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Seer Green & Jordans to Plumley start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Seer Green & Jordans to Plumley start from £81.40 one way, or £116.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Seer Green & Jordans to Plumley are available for £125.80 one way, or £251.40 return

Facilities and Amenities

When it comes to facilities, Seer Green & Jordans offers a range of essentials that cover basic commuter needs. The ticket office is available on weekdays from 06:10 to 10:40,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ets comfortably. Ticket machines are present and designed to be accessible to all, making your entry and exit swift and uncomplicated. The station features a step-free access option, though it's limited mainly to platform 2 for London-bound trains. Customer assistance is readily available through help points and staff presence during ticket office hours to assist travelers with queries and enhancements to their experience.

Accessibility is a concern that's addressed with thought. There are some limitations, such as the lack of accessible toilets, but provisions like induction loops, accessible ticket machines, and ramps are present. Those needing assistance can book it in advance for peace of mind using the Passenger Assist initiative—more details can be found here.

Onward Travel Options

While the station doesn't cater to rail replacement buses due to tricky road access, travelers are encouraged to use the help point at the station to arrange alternative transportation like taxis to nearby Chiltern Railways stations. Facilities and Amenities at Plumley Train Station

Plumley Train Station, though lacking a ticket office, ensures passengers can seamlessly continue their journeys with the help of ticket machines that allow both purchasing and collection of tickets bought online. While there is no dedicated staff to assist at all times, the station provides an induction loop for the hearing impaired and a helpline for any urgent assistance needed (call 08002006060).

Accessibility is a priority here. Whilst the station is designated as scooter-friendly with step-free access to the Manchester platform, do note that accessibility to trains depends on the rolling stock in use. If planning a journey that requires assistance, it's recommended to pre-arrange through the Passenger Assist service, which provides help up to two hours before your planned departure.

Connecting Travel Options from Plumley

Plumley Station connects more than just train lines. The station provides a Rail Replacement Service with pick-up and drop-off at Plumley Moor Road, offering a convenient alternative when needed. For local travel, options such as bus services through taxi bookings and Busline's services (dial 0871 200 2233) are readily available.

Unfortunately, there isn’t bicycle hire available directly at the station, but the Cheshire countryside offers fantastic routes for those cycling enthusiasts willing to bring their own bikes.
